MATLABのキャリブレーションツールのデータを使う

Calibration Tool for MATLABキャリブレーションを行った結果として出力するデータの扱いについて。
画像一枚一枚についてこんな感じで出てくる。

%-- Image #1:
omc_1 = [ 2.221232e+000 ; 2.221232e+000 ; 4.500846e-004 ];
Tc_1 = [ -3.004547e+002 ; -4.499652e+002 ; 2.995352e+003 ];
omc_error_1 = [ 6.025453e-003 ; 6.024149e-003 ; 1.332764e-002 ];
Tc_error_1 = [ 1.934331e+001 ; 2.172821e+001 ; 2.124238e+001 ];

今の作業ではこのうちomc_1とTc_1だけを数値として使いたいので、他の部分にマッチングするような正規表現を頑張って書いてみた。

omc_error.*\n|Tc_error.*\n|omc_[0-9]+ += \[ |Tc_[0-9]+ += \[ | ;|\];|%.*\n

正規表現ははじめて使ったけれど、とりあえず|(または)がすっげぇ便利。
きちんと使うために一度メタ文字まとめるかも。